2006 is the 135th year after the founding of the City of Birmingham.

Events

  • February 3: Three Birmingham college students set fire to 9 rural Alabama churches.
  • February 20: 16th Street Baptist Church designated a National Historic Landmark.
  • February 26: ESPN Classic televises a re-created Negro League game from Rickwood Field.
  • March 20: Torchmark announces their move to Texas.
  • March 30: Cirque du Soleil makes it's Birmingham debut with "Delirium".
  • April 7: Mike Davis names UAB's head men's basketball coach.
